摘要

The invention relates to digital communication technology and can be used in railway transport for organization of operative-technological communication between railway workers in charge of forming train movement. The technical result is aimed at optimization of channel resources of primary networks of operative-technological communication by forming a lower level ring, the functions of a bypass direction of which are executed by a part of an upper level ring. A system includes a double-level ring network architecture based on the lower and upper level rings. The main direction of the upper level ring includes a control station with control boards. At each section of the operative-technological communication in points of the lower level ring there are provided a bridge station and executive stations with control boards. The executive stations and the bridge station are connected in series to the main direction of the lower level ring, for forming a bypass direction of which the stations provided in extreme ring points, are connected to the network with packet switching via corresponding gateways. The bridge stations are connected in series to the main direction of the upper level ring and for forming a bypass direction of the upper level ring its main direction is connected to the network with packet switching via other corresponding gateways.
